Understanding Woodworking Plans: A Deconstruction

A well-structured woodworking plan acts as your roadmap, providing a clear and concise set of instructions to build a specific piece. Understanding its components is paramount to successful project execution. A comprehensive plan should include several key elements:

Detailed Diagrams and Illustrations: The Visual Blueprint

High-quality diagrams are essential. These visuals should include:

  • Orthographic Projections: Multiple views (front, side, top) of the project, illustrating dimensions and key features.
  • Isometric Drawings: Three-dimensional representations offering a clearer perspective of the assembled piece.
  • Detailed Component Drawings: Individual diagrams showing dimensions, angles, and joinery details for each part.
  • Assembly Diagrams: Step-by-step visuals illustrating the sequence of joining components.

These diagrams must be clear, accurate, and scaled appropriately. Ambiguity can lead to costly errors and frustration, so ensure the plans are easily understandable.

Comprehensive Cut Lists: Material Specification and Quantification

The cut list is a crucial component, providing a detailed inventory of all the lumber required for the project. This list typically specifies:

  • Wood Type: Precise specification of the wood species (e.g., oak, maple, pine), influencing both the aesthetic and the working properties.
  • Dimensions: Accurate measurements of each piece, including length, width, and thickness.
  • Quantity: The number of pieces required for each component.
  • Orientation: Indicating the grain direction where crucial for strength and appearance.

A well-defined cut list minimizes waste and ensures you have all the necessary materials before commencing construction.

Step-by-Step Instructions: A Guided Construction Process

Clear, concise, and sequential instructions are the backbone of any successful woodworking plan. These instructions should:

  • Outline each step in a logical order: Progressing from preparation to assembly and finishing.
  • Specify tools and techniques: Clearly identify the necessary tools and the appropriate techniques for each stage.
  • Include safety precautions: Highlight safety measures to mitigate risks associated with woodworking.
  • Offer tips and troubleshooting advice: Provide practical advice to address potential challenges during construction.

The instructions should be written in a manner that is easily understood, even for novice woodworkers.

Selecting Appropriate Woodworking Plans

Choosing the right plan is crucial for a successful project. Consider the following factors:

Skill Level Assessment: Matching Plans to Your Capabilities

Woodworking plans are often categorized by skill level (beginner, intermediate, advanced). Accurately assessing your capabilities is essential. Starting with a beginner-level project allows you to build confidence and develop fundamental skills before tackling more complex designs. Attempting a project beyond your skill level can lead to frustration and potentially dangerous situations.

Project Scope and Time Commitment: Realistic Expectations

Carefully evaluate the project's scope and the time commitment required. Realistic assessment prevents disappointment and ensures a manageable workload. Consider factors such as the complexity of the design, the number of components, and the required finishing techniques.

Style and Design Preferences: Aligning with Your Aesthetic

Select a plan that complements your personal style and design preferences. Whether you prefer rustic, modern, or traditional styles, ensure the project aligns with your aesthetic vision.

Source Reliability: Ensuring Plan Accuracy and Completeness

The source of the woodworking plan is paramount. Reputable sources, such as established woodworking magazines, websites, or books, typically offer high-quality, thoroughly tested plans. Be wary of plans from unreliable sources, as inaccuracies can lead to significant issues during construction.

Material Selection and Preparation: Foundation of Quality

Once you've chosen your plan, selecting and preparing the materials is crucial. This involves:

Wood Species Selection: Balancing Aesthetics and Functionality

The choice of wood species directly impacts the project's aesthetic appeal, durability, and workability. Hardwoods such as oak, maple, and cherry offer greater strength and durability but can be more challenging to work with. Softwoods like pine and fir are easier to work with but may be less durable. Consider the intended use of the finished piece when making your selection.

Lumber Grading and Quality Control: Ensuring Consistent Material

Examine the lumber carefully for defects such as knots, cracks, and warping. Understanding lumber grading systems helps ensure consistent quality throughout the project. Using high-quality lumber significantly impacts the final product's appearance and longevity.

Material Preparation: Cutting, Planing, and Sanding

Before assembly, prepare the lumber by cutting it to the dimensions specified in the plan. Planing and sanding ensure smooth surfaces for superior joinery and a professional finish. Accurate preparation is fundamental to a successful project.

Essential Tools and Techniques: Mastering the Fundamentals

Woodworking requires a range of tools and techniques. Familiarize yourself with the tools required for your specific project and practice the necessary techniques before commencing construction. This could include:

  • Measuring and Marking: Accurate measurements are paramount. Master the use of rulers, tape measures, and marking tools.
  • Cutting: Learn how to use saws (hand saws, circular saws, jigsaws) to accurately cut lumber to the required dimensions.
  • Joinery: Master various joinery techniques (e.g., mortise and tenon, dovetail, dado) depending on the plan's requirements.
  • Finishing: Learn about sanding, staining, and sealing techniques to protect and enhance the finished piece.

Practice each technique thoroughly to ensure accuracy and efficiency during the project. Safety should always be prioritized when using power tools.
